There seems to be a problem some users experience upgrading to Acrobat 11.0.04 on Mac Book Pro's that support Retina Display.
In certain cases, Acrobat still runs in low definition and the setting "Open in Low Resolution" is checked and grayed-out (can't be changed).
One cause we've identified is a preference file that is not updated in certain cases and prevents the system from letting Acrobat running in Retina Display mode.
To fix it you can try this:
- Uninstall Acrobat 11
- Remove Library/Preferences/com.adobe.PDFAdminSettings.plist
- Install Acrobat 11 again
- Use Help/update to upgrade to 11.0.4
One of the knwon workflows is upgrading from a previous version of Acrobat that had been installed before a system upgrade, or from an old version of Acrobat such as 9 that is not supported on Mac OS 10.8.
